WebAug 2, 2024 · Rubrics are sets of scoring guidelines that teachers can use to provide consistency in grading a student’s work. Grading rubrics or grading scales are beneficial for both students and teachers. They help teachers avoid repetitive feedback and can be recycled for other assignments, which saves time on grading. WebWhen grading an exam or assignment with multiple sections, grade all responses to the same question (or set of related questions) together. From the course navigation menu, click Grades. To open … notifications display timeWebSep 30, 2024 · Curving Grades Mathematically 1 Set the highest grade as "100%". This is one of the most common (if not the most common) methods teachers and professors use for curving grades. This curving method requires the teacher to find the highest score in the class and set this as the "new" 100% for the assignment. how to sew self binding baby blanket
